Haven't touched the PS2 / PSX versions.

I will say that it's probably easier to use a computer mouse to set up the world, and you can use whatever image program you're comfortable with to make your own graphics. Not only that, but you can grab tons of pre-made graphics right off of the internet.

I don't see any advantage for the PS2 version over the computer version, as far as actually making an RPG. Haven't played the console versions, though.
